abelykh0 / esp32-z80emu

Spectrum ZX Emulator on ESP32 VGA32 board
30 stars 4 forks source link

Compiling error #1

Closed fg1998 closed 3 years ago

fg1998 commented 3 years ago

Compiling Error - PlatformIO VSCode win10 Using FABGl 0.9.0 (current)

Some directions ?

------------------CUT HERE------------------- Compiling .pio\build\pico32\lib738\FabGL@0.8.0\canvas.cpp.o In file included from lib/Display/Screen.h:5:0, from include/Emulator.h:4, from src\emulator.cpp:1: lib/Display/VideoController.h:13:1: error: expected class-name before '{' token { ^ In file included from lib/Display/Screen.h:5:0, from include/Emulator.h:4, from src\FileSystem.cpp:7: lib/Display/VideoController.h:13:1: error: expected class-name before '{' token { ^ [.pio\build\pico32\src\FileSystem.cpp.o] Error 1 src\emulator.cpp: In function 'void startKeyboard()': src\emulator.cpp:53:2: error: 'quickCheckHardware' is not a member of 'fabgl::Mouse' Mouse::quickCheckHardware(); ^ [.pio\build\pico32\src\emulator.cpp.o] Error 1 In file included from lib/Display/Screen.h:5:0, from include/emulator.h:4, from src\main.cpp:3: lib/Display/VideoController.h:13:1: error: expected class-name before '{' token { ^ *** [.pio\build\pico32\src\main.cpp.o] Error 1

abelykh0 commented 3 years ago

Unfortunately ,this one requires the latest (unreleased) FabGL because I am using a new VGADirectController .